Yeon Jae Ko is a scholar working on Atomic and Molecular Physics, and Optics, Inorganic Chemistry and Molecular Biology. According to data from OpenAlex, Yeon Jae Ko has authored 30 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Atomic and Molecular Physics, and Optics, 13 papers in Inorganic Chemistry and 10 papers in Molecular Biology. Recurrent topics in Yeon Jae Ko’s work include Advanced Chemical Physics Studies (19 papers), DNA and Nucleic Acid Chemistry (10 papers) and Synthesis and Properties of Inorganic Cluster Compounds (8 papers). Yeon Jae Ko is often cited by papers focused on Advanced Chemical Physics Studies (19 papers), DNA and Nucleic Acid Chemistry (10 papers) and Synthesis and Properties of Inorganic Cluster Compounds (8 papers). Yeon Jae Ko collaborates with scholars based in United States, Poland and Germany. Yeon Jae Ko's co-authors include Kit H. Bowen, Haopeng Wang, Andrej Grubisic, Hyuk Kang, Kang Taek Lee, Seong Keun Kim, P. Jena, Anil K. Kandalam, Boggavarapu Kiran and Sarah T. Stokes and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and The Journal of Chemical Physics.
